加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0578zz.com/)- 应用程序、AI行业应用、CDN、低代码、区块链!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

Android视角:MSSQL精要教程与索引优化

发布时间:2026-02-06 13:01:25 所属栏目:MsSql教程 来源:DaWei
导读:  在Android开发中,虽然主要使用的是SQLite数据库,但有时候也需要与MSSQL进行数据交互。MSSQL(Microsoft SQL Server)是企业级应用中常用的数据库系统,掌握其核心概念对于开发者来说非常重要。  MSSQL的基本

  在Android开发中,虽然主要使用的是SQLite数据库,但有时候也需要与MSSQL进行数据交互。MSSQL(Microsoft SQL Server)是企业级应用中常用的数据库系统,掌握其核心概念对于开发者来说非常重要。


  MSSQL的基本结构包括数据库、表、视图和存储过程等。数据库是数据的容器,表则是数据的组织形式。每个表由行和列组成,行代表记录,列定义字段类型和约束。理解这些基础结构有助于更好地设计和管理数据。


AI图片,仅供参考

  索引是提升查询性能的关键工具。在MSSQL中,索引类似于书籍的目录,可以快速定位数据。合理创建索引能够显著减少查询时间,但过多的索引会影响写入性能。因此,需要根据实际查询需求来选择合适的字段建立索引。


  优化索引策略时,应关注查询的频率和模式。例如,经常用于WHERE子句或JOIN操作的字段适合建立索引。同时,避免对低基数字段(如性别、状态)建立索引,因为它们对查询性能的提升有限。


  除了单列索引,复合索引也是常见的优化手段。复合索引由多个字段组成,适用于多条件查询场景。但需要注意字段顺序,通常将选择性高的字段放在前面。


  定期分析和维护索引也很重要。随着数据量的增长,索引可能会变得碎片化,影响性能。使用MSSQL提供的维护工具,如重建或重新组织索引,可以保持数据库的高效运行。


  站长个人见解,MSSQL的核心在于数据结构的理解和索引的合理运用。通过不断实践和优化,开发者可以更高效地处理复杂的数据需求。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章